How they compare
Thailand currently reports 170,924 1000 USD against 179 1000 USD in Venezuela (Bolivarian Republic of), a difference of 170,745 1000 USD.
That makes Thailand's figure about 954.9 times Venezuela (Bolivarian Republic of)'s.
Across all 8 years both countries report, Thailand has been ahead every year.
Thailand ranks 3rd and Venezuela (Bolivarian Republic of) ranks 4th of 90 countries.
Thailand has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
